Details for Roman Actus (Ancient Survey)
Introduction : The Roman actus measured approximately 35.5 meters (120 Roman feet), serving as a standard unit for land surveying and agricultural planning in ancient Rome. This measurement organized centuriation systems across the empire.
History & Origin : Developed during the Roman Republic for land division. The actus was the standard furrow length plowed by oxen before turning. Fundamental to Roman surveying practices documented by Frontinus and Hyginus.
Current Use : Used to lay out Roman agricultural fields (2 actus = 1 jugerum). Survives in archaeological analysis of Roman land grids. The decumanus maximus in Roman cities often measured multiples of actus.
Details for Light-year (Astronomical Distance)
Introduction : A light-year is the distance light travels in one Julian year (365.25 days) in a vacuum, approximately 9.46 trillion kilometers. This immense unit makes interstellar distances comprehensible and is astronomy's most recognizable distance measurement for the public.
History & Origin : First conceptualized in 1838 when Friedrich Bessel first measured stellar distances. The term became popular in the mid-19th century as astronomers began understanding galactic scales. Modern definitions use the speed of light (299,792,458 m/s) with precise time measurements.
Current Use : Used to express distances between stars and galaxies in public astronomy. Proxima Centauri is 4.24 light-years away. While professional astronomers often use parsecs, light-years dominate educational materials and popular science for their intuitive understanding.
